Mathew 12:49 – July 20, 2021

And stretching out his hand toward his disciples, he said, “Here are my mother and my brothers.” Mathew 12:49 NABRE           

Jesus leads us to a new family, to our true family. While preaching, someone tells Jesus His mother and brothers are outside desiring to speak to Him. Jesus asks, who are my mother and brothers and answering His own question says those who do the will of My heavenly Father. Jesus desires all disciples be sisters and brothers, in fact Jesus desires we see Him as brother. Christians are meant to create a community that models family, nothing can break up a family and families are always available for one another. Those who obey Jesus have a special relationship with Him deeper than natural family bonds. Jesus wants more for those who follow Him than a blond bond, He desires a bond that is rooted in love. The communities that Jesus seeks be created in His name, should be places where love is the bond and all are supported. Today’s churches should be these places but somehow culture has kept the church community as fellowship not brotherhood. Until we are able to love each other, putting our Christian sister or brother first, we are not creating the kingdom of heaven Jesus came to reveal. 

We see how this teaching is on Jesus mind even in death. In the gospel of John (19:25-27) we read Jesus connecting John the disciple with His mother from the cross. John is declared as son and Jesus mother becomes the mother of John. This is the type of family Jesus seeks. His mother stood at the foot of the cross and Jesus desires that she be mother in the community, mother to all, rather than His mother who carried Him into this world. 

Who are your siblings? Do you seek familial bonds in Christian community?
